Description
Demelza Carne, the miner's daughter Ross Poldark rescued from a fairground rabble, is now his wife. But the events of these turbulent years will test their marriage and their love. Ross begins a bitter struggle for the rights of the mining communities -- and sows the seeds of an enduring enmity with powerful George Warleggan.
